结合山西“十二五”期间的规划,以2012年为分析年限,进行了山西电网丰大、丰小开机方式大规模风电纳入的系统调峰研究,包括改善电源结构及电源调峰特性和改善负荷的峰谷差等方面的系统分析。在一定电源结构的情况下,对系统可能存在的调峰风险进行了评估,得出相应的较优调峰方案和控制策略,取得较大调峰裕度,优化系统的潮流,从而维持系统的安全稳定。
